I recently got a suspension kit from EBAY, the Tokico set that includes complete struts and springs.. I had to get the mounts for it ... the rear ones work great, but the fronts look like the're missing something when you look at the OEM one,

My question is, is there anything special I need to do it all so i can have a proper ride? right now I put the OEM ones on the Tokico set but the front ones are making noise everytime I hit something small on the road.. there is a washer thing that holds the strut in place to the mount and its not sitting right where the strut mount sits/bolts on to the car?

Both strut mount designs for these cars are crap, and now that your lowered plan on going through a set every 1-2 years. The ones in the picture there have been on my car for 3.5 years, but only saw 1,000 miles and they are shot. That suspension is going on my sunfire probably this weekend, and the Cavalier is getting the Tein SS with solid pillow ball mounts, which will never go bad. I'm sick of changing them already. This is set # 5 for my white sedan, the ones in the sunfire are shot too cause they are clunking now.
